Output efb5e7a2ef57c255116619bff38daa8c548e161eda92b40d08554ec2fe1cbc39:0

value
218164
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65eb504deae2540158c162acfbd720b1ffdf4587 OP_EQUAL
address
3Ayv4oNgaGijCcfVwi99AyWuTZeWALUZz2
transaction
efb5e7a2ef57c255116619bff38daa8c548e161eda92b40d08554ec2fe1cbc39
confirmations
103009
spent
true